The Prophet ﷺ came to visit me when I was ill in Mecca.I said, "Messenger of Allah, shall I bequeath all of my wealth?"He said, "No."I said, "Then half?"He said, "No."I said, "Then a third?"He said, "A third, and a third is a lot. To leave your heirs wealthy is better than to leave them destitute, begging from people, stretching out their hands."

Bukhari narrated it in Wasaya, chapter "That a man should leave his heirs wealthy is better than that they should beg from people," Hadith 2742, from Abu Naeem, and Muslim in Wasiyyah, chapter "Bequeathing a third," Hadith 1628, from the hadith of Sufyan bin Uyayna in the same wording, and it is in Al-Kubra, Hadith 6454.
